[0055] Puncture into a patient's circulatory system may require the use of a needle, catheter, or other device for creating a puncture to pierce the patient's skin. Procedures that may require puncture into the circulatory system may include dialysis, hemofiltration, hemofiltration, blood donation, blood detoxification, blood component replacement, cardiac catheterization, other blood processing procedures. During dialysis treatment using a dialysis machine, the needle may place the circulatory system in fluid communication with the extracorporeal system. Blood circulates through the extracorporeal system and undergoes filtration within the extracorporeal system.

[0056] In some cases, blood from the patient can leak through the puncture site onto the patient's skin. For example, during treatment, the needle may be displaced from the puncture site due to patient movement or inadvertent contact with the needle, which may result in patient blood loss.

Abstract

A medical wetness sensing device includes a base adapted to be disposed on a wearer of the medical wetness sensing device. The base includes a first electrical conductor and a second electrical conductor electrically insulated from the first electrical conductor. The first electrical conductor includes a hinge that enables a first portion of the first electrical conductor to deflect at the hinge relative to a second portion of the first electrical conductor. The medical wetness sensing device includes a controller electrically connected to the first electrical conductor and the second electrical conductor. The controller is configured to detect the presence or absence of medical fluid electrically connecting the first electrical conductor and the second electrical conductor.

[0001] This application claims priority to US Patent Application No. 15 / 479,777, filed April 5, 2017, which is incorporated herein by reference. technical field [0002] The present application relates to systems and devices for sensing wetness, and in particular, to systems and devices for sensing wetness during dialysis treatments. Background technique [0003] During a dialysis treatment, arterial and venipuncture needles are typically inserted into a patient so that blood can be withdrawn from the patient through the arterial needle, flow through a dialyzer to filter the blood, and then returned to the patient through the venipuncture needle. In some cases, the venipuncture needle may begin to dislodge. In the event that such an event is ignored, the arterial needle may continue to withdraw blood from the patient, while the displaced venipuncture needle cannot return blood to the patient.
